Blockchain'de doğrulayıcının rolü
Doğrulayıcılar ayrıca, çifte harcama gibi kötü amaçlı faaliyetlere karşı ağı izleyerek blok zincirinin güvenliğini sağlamaktan da sorumludur. “Çifte harcama” terimi, aynı para biriminin iki kez harcanması anlamına gelir. Blok zincirleri, açık defteri kriptografik algoritmalara bağlayarak bunu önler.
Doğrulayıcılar, temel blok zincirlerinin yerel kripto para birimi cinsinden ödeme alırlar. Örneğin, Solana blok zincirindeki doğrulayıcılara SOL (SOL) cinsinden ödeme yapılır.
Hisse kanıtı (PoS) doğrulayıcıları nasıl çalışır?
PoS blok zincirlerinde doğrulayıcıların üç ana rolü vardır: doğrulayıcı istemcisi, düğüm operatörü ve stake miktarı. Doğrulayıcı istemcisi, blok zincirinin durumunu doğrulamak için özel anahtarları tutan ve kullanan bir yazılım uygulamasıdır. Düğüm operatörü, doğrulayıcı istemci yazılımını ve donanımını çalıştıran ve yöneten bir kişi veya kuruluştur. Bahis miktarı, doğrulayıcı olmak için bir kişi veya kuruluş tarafından teminat olarak yatırılan kripto para birimini ifade eder.
Doğrulayıcılar havuzundan tek bir doğrulayıcı, bir blok önermek için rastgele seçilir. Teklif sahibi bloğu hazırlar ve teklifi tüm ağa yayınlar. Doğrulayıcılar topluluğu, blokta önerilen işlemleri onaylar. Yalnızca doğrulanmış işlemlerin kesinliğe ulaştığını unutmamak önemlidir.
Ethereum blok zincirinde, işlemlerin doğrulanma hızını hızlandırmak amacıyla doğrulayıcıların toplam sayısı, birkaç bloğu aynı anda işlemek için çeşitli alt kümelere ayrılmıştır. Doğrulayıcıların blok zincirinin durumu üzerinde mutabakata varma işlevine fikir birliği denir.
Ağ kullanıcılarının bir sonraki bloğu doğrulamak için delegeleri seçmek üzere oy kullandığı, delege edilmiş hisse kanıtı (DPoS) blok zincirleri de vardır. PoS ile karşılaştırıldığında DPoS, merkeziyetten ödün vermeden doğrulayıcıların sayısı azaltıldığı için daha iyi düzenlenmiş yönetim ve daha hızlı fikir birliği sağlar. Delegeler kazanılan ödülleri kendilerini seçen kullanıcılar arasında dağıtır.
Yetki kanıtı (PoA) doğrulayıcıları nasıl çalışır?
Bir PoA konsensüs mekanizması, yeni bloklar oluşturmak ve ağın doğruluğunu korumakla görevlendirilmiş, önceden seçilmiş küçük bir doğrulayıcılar grubundan oluşur. Güvenilir kişi veya kuruluşların doğrulayıcı olarak seçildiği ve merkezi olmayan yönetimin önceliğinin düşük olduğu özel veya kurumsal blok zincirlerinde iyi hizmet verir.
Doğrulayıcı olarak bir PoA ağına girmek için kişinin genellikle blockchain üzerinde resmi bir kimliğe sahip olması, ev sahibi kuruluşla bir ilişkisi olması ve sabıka kaydı olmaması gerekir. İndüksiyon sonrasında, işlemleri doğrulamak ve blok zincirine blok eklemek onlara emanet edilir.
Doğrulayıcılar, PoS ağlarında işlemleri yönetmek ve bloklar oluşturmak için özel yazılımlar çalıştırır. Doğrulayıcılar genellikle hisselerine göre blok önermek üzere seçilir. Bazı sistemlerde, her blok için “lider düğüm” olarak bir doğrulayıcı seçilir ve onu ağa önermekle görevlendirilir.
Bu lider daha sonra diğer doğrulayıcılar tarafından fikir birliği yoluyla doğrulanır ve bloğun blok zincirine eklenmeden önce geçerliliği sağlanır. Bu lider düğümü seçme kriterleri ve süreci, farklı PoS uygulamalarına göre önemli ölçüde farklılık gösterebilir.
Doğrulayan bir düğüm, kötü niyetli veya hileli bir işlemi onaylarsa, belirli bir süre için doğrulama düğümleri listesinden çıkarılma veya tamamen yasaklanma şeklinde cezalandırılabilir.
Madenciler ve doğrulayıcılar arasındaki fark nedir?
Hem madenciler hem de doğrulayıcılar işlemlerin doğruluğunu sağlar ve blok zincirine bloklar ekler. Ancak sorumlulukları ve işleyiş şekilleri üzerinde çalıştıkları blockchain türüne göre farklılık göstermektedir.
PoW sistemlerinde madenciler, blok zincirine blok eklemek için karmaşık bulmacaları çözerler. Bu süreçte, işlemleri kazdıkları bloklara dahil ederek doğruluyorlar. Bu bulmacaları çözmek, diğer madencilerle rekabet ederken muazzam bir hesaplama gücü gerektirir. Sorunu ilk çözen madenci, bloğunu blok zincirine ekler ve yerel kripto para birimi veya işlem ücretleri ile ödüllendirilir.
Doğrulayıcılara PoS ve PoA blok zincirlerindeki işlemleri doğrulama görevi verilir. Ethereum gibi PoS blok zincirlerinde, teminat olarak belirledikleri madeni paraların sayısına göre seçilirler. Öte yandan PoA blok zincirlerinde itibarlarına ve kimliklerine göre seçilirler. Sistem, işlemleri ve dürüst davranışları onaylayan doğrulayıcıları ödüllendirir.
Doğrulayıcı düğümü çalıştırma süreci nedir?
Doğrulayıcı düğüm olarak çalışmaya başlamak altı noktalı bir süreçtir. Bir blockchain seçmeyi, donanım kurmayı, yazılımı kurmayı, doğrulayıcı olarak katılmayı, düğümü izlemeyi ve ödülleri yönetmeyi içerir.
Doğrulayıcı düğümün verimli bir şekilde çalıştırılması bir dizi adım gerektirir:
Bir blockchain seçin
İlk adım, tercihen yüksek işlem hacmine sahip ve doğrulayıcılara ihtiyaç duyan bir blok zinciri seçmektir.
Donanım yükleyin
Düğümü çalıştırmak için doğrulayıcıların yeterli RAM, depolama ve işlem gücüne sahip bir bilgisayara ihtiyacı olacaktır. Her blockchain'in donanım gereksinimlerine ilişkin kendine has özellikleri vardır.
Yazılım seçin
Doğrulayıcının, seçtikleri blockchain için yazılım programını kurması ve yapılandırması gerekir. Tüm blok zincirleri farklı doğrulama yazılımı kullanır. Yazılımı güncel tutun ve doğrulayıcı düğümleri bilgisayar korsanlığı girişimlerinden korumak için güçlü parolalar kullanın.
Doğrulayıcı olarak katılın
PoS blok zincirleri, kişinin gereken miktarda kripto para birimini stake etmesini ve doğrulayıcı olarak ağa katılmasını gerektirir. Öte yandan, PoA blok zincirlerine katılmak için kişinin kimlik kanıtına ihtiyacı olacaktır. Bazı blok zincirleri, doğrulayıcıların bir doğrulayıcı havuzuna katılmasını gerektirir.
Düğümü izleyin
Doğrulayıcıların, düğümün düzgün çalışmasını sağlamak ve ortaya çıkabilecek sorunları düzeltmek için düğümlerini sürekli izlemesi gerekir.
Ödülleri yönet
Blok zincirleri, doğrulayıcılara kripto para birimi biçiminde ödeme yapar. Doğrulayıcıların ödül yapısı ve ödüllerini talep etme süreci konusunda bilgili olmaları gerekir.
Blockchain doğrulama alanında ortaya çıkan trendler ve yenilikler
Trendlerden biri, geleneksel PoW ve PoS modellerinin ötesinde fikir birliği yöntemleri geliştirmektir. Yanma kanıtı (PoB), PoA ve alan kanıtı (PoSpace) gibi protokoller, kullanıcı katılımı, güvenlik ve enerji verimliliğine odaklanan farklı doğrulama yöntemleri sağlar.
Bir diğer yenilik ise, doğrulayıcıların temel verileri açıklamadan işlemleri onaylamasına olanak tanıyarak güvenliği ve gizliliği artıran sıfır bilgi kanıtlarının kullanılmasıdır. Ayrıca, daha entegre ve etkili bir blockchain ekosistemini teşvik etmek amacıyla farklı blockchain platformları arasındaki iletişimi ve değer transferini kolaylaştırmak için birlikte çalışabilirlik çözümleri geliştirilmektedir.
Bu ilerlemeler, blockchain teknolojisinde yeni bir çağ başlattı ve blockchain'i birçok sektörde daha yaygın olarak uygulanabilir, erişilebilir ve sürdürülebilir hale getirdi.